### Step 4: Rebuild the Autocomplete Index

If typeahead latency in Pellgrove exceeds ~400ms after deploy, the suggestion index likely needs a rebuild. Run `pell index rebuild --shard all` during a low-traffic window; rebuilds take roughly twenty minutes per shard. Plugin authors should not ship custom analyzers that bypass the shared tokenizer — they fragment the index and slow everyone down. Once the rebuild completes, sign the index manifest with the key below.

release key, kahif-yagap: bky3_1JN

Ticket: Staging env misconfigured for Siftgate bloom filter

The bloom layer in front of the Pellet KV store is rejecting all lookups in staging because the env file was copied from the dev template without credentials. False-positive tuning values are fine; only the auth line is missing. To unblock the weekly demo, the Pellet admission secret must be set on the following line.

env line for yaguf-fajop: LEDGER_TOKEN13=fb08984397349

This PR reworks the Tallbridge fleet fuel-usage report to aggregate per-depot rather than per-vehicle, fixing the double-counting seen in the Ashgrove rollout. All figures were cross-checked against last quarter's manual audit. Please review the smoothing and outlier thresholds carefully, as they directly affect the published numbers.

constants for fawep-yagap:
QUOTAS = {
    "noveth": 275,
    "oliion": 740,
}

To the release channel — welcome aboard to our new contractor on the Tarnwell fleet tooling. The October fuel-usage report is now generated by the revised aggregator, which reconciles pump logs against odometer deltas and flags variances over 4%. Please review the summary tab before distribution and note any depot anomalies in the tracker. The report was produced by the build referenced below.

trace token, tawep-fahif: htk3_b58

## Audit-Log Viewer: Limits & Quotas

The Ledgerpane viewer enforces strict query limits to keep the audit store responsive for everyone. Each support session may run a bounded number of searches per minute, and result sets are truncated rather than paginated past the hard cap — please explain this to customers before escalating. Exceeding the export quota queues the request rather than failing it. The enforced limits are defined as follows:

tuning table, faduf-baduf:
PRIORITIES = {
    "ulavan": 191,
    "silys": 750,
    "goriel": 238,
    "kelmir": 66,
    "wendor": 432,
}